Baby Mamas

Film

by Stephina Zwane

Details

South Africa / 2018 / 93mins / Drama, Romantic Comedy / English

Baby Mamas is a comedic-drama revolving around the daily lives and loves of four professional women who are all in various stages of their own real-life ‘baby mama drama.’ A sisterhood develops among these four very different women, as they find in each other the strength and courage it will take to navigate the treacherous waters of the relationships, good and bad, that they have with the men in their lives.

About the Director

Stephina Zwane

Stephina Zwane, company director, writer and filmmaker, has a BA Journalism from the University of Johannesburg and has 18 years’ experience in the TV industry. She has also worked as a TV producer and director on various shows for the major broadcasters in South Africa. She is the co-owner of Sorele Media and directed her debut feature film Love and Kwaito in 2016. Most recently, she wrote and directed, the comedic-drama Baby Mamas, which was selected for the Toronto Black Film Festival, the New York African Film Festival, the Durban International Film Festival as well as the Lights, Camera, Africa Film Festival in 2018.
